The apartment is situated in a very convenient location. 5 mins to Metro Palos de la Frontera, 10 mins to Atocha train station, 2 mins to Carrefour Express, 7 mins to Lidl supermarket. There is also another big supermarket Dia nearby. Above all, the building provides free luggage storage facilities in 3,4 & 5 floors. You need €1 to operate the locker but you can it back when returning the key. That’s real convenient.

• The bed was very comfortable and provided a good night’s sleep. • The air conditioning did not have heating, but the blanket was thick enough to keep warm; the temperature that night was around 13°C. • The room was very spacious—enough to fully open two large suitcases on the floor with plenty of space left to walk around. • The bathroom included a hairdryer. • The shower drain seemed slightly clogged, causing slow drainage; we had to keep the water pressure low while showering. • No drinking water was provided in the room, but the front desk informed us that the tap water from the bathroom sink is safe to drink. • There was no kettle in the room, but you can request hot water from the front desk—they kindly provided it from the cafeteria free of charge. • Although the hotel is not located right in the tourist center and isn’t within short walking distance to major attractions, it has excellent transport links: there are both a bus stop and a metro station right outside and around the corner. • It’s very convenient whether you’re arriving from Atocha Station or heading to key destinations like Madrid Royal Palace, Moncloa Bus Terminal (for Segovia express), Plaza Eliptica (for Toledo express), or Estacion de Autobuses Madrid Sur (for Porto overnight bus). • The front desk staff were extremely friendly and helpful. On the day of check-out, we left our luggage there for free while we visited Toledo. When we returned around 6:00 PM, they even provided hot water for our instant noodles. We rested in the cafeteria for a few hours before heading to catch our overnight bus to Porto. • Their assistance made our trip much smoother and more comfortable.
